T. Ishida et al., FERROMAGNETISM OF PYRIMIDINE-BRIDGED COPPER(II) COMPLEXES, Molecular crystals and liquid crystals science and technology. Section A, Molecular crystals and liquid crystals, 278, 1996, pp. 87-96
The magnetic measurements of polymeric complexes [L . Cu(hfac)(2)](n),
(L = pyrimidine, 4-methylpyrimidine, and quinazoline) revealed the pr
esence of ferromagnetic interactions among the copper spins. The X-ray
crystal-structure analysis of the pyrimidine and quinazoline complexe
s showed a copper-ligand alternating chain. The ferromagnetic transiti
on of the quinazoline complex was observed at about 0.12 K. Pyrimidine
(2)-Cu(ClO4)(2) complex was found to be a ferromagnet with a transitio
n temperature of about 10 K.
